Knights Defend MIAC Crown; Ruth Steinke Grabs Individual Title
With junior Ruth Steinke leading the way, the Carleton College women s cross country team won its second straight MIAC Championship Crown. This was the Knights seventh overall MIAC title and third over the last four years.

MIAC Cross Country Championships Preview
The 2014 Minnesota Intercollegiate Athletic Conference (MIAC) Cross Country Championships will be Saturday, Nov. 1 at Como Golf Course. The eight-kilometer men s race will begin at 2:15 p.m. with the women tackling the six-kilometer course at 3:15 p.m.
